首先,在需要获取class的节点上添加ref属性,例如: <div ref="myDiv" class="my-class"></div> 然后,在Vue组件中,可以通过this.$refs来访问该节点,并使用classList属性来获取节点的class,如下所示: mounted() { const myDivClass = this.$refs.myDiv.classList; console.
通过ref属性获取DOM元素的class:在Vue组件中,可以通过给DOM元素添加ref属性来获取其class。首先,在DOM元素上添加ref属性,例如。然后,在Vue组件的方法中使用this.$refs来访问该DOM元素,例如this.$refs.myDiv。通过this.$refs.myDiv,就可以获取到该DOM元素的class。 通过querySelector方法获取DOM元素的class:Vue组件中...
this.$refs[pri][0].setAttribute("class","xxxx xxxxx");
通过ref属性和$refs可以直接获取到DOM元素,而使用原生的JavaScript方法也是一种可行的方式。在实际开发中,可以根据具体情况来选择最合适的方法来获取DOM元素的class,并结合computed属性和watch属性来实现更复杂的功能。 在Vue开发中,获取DOM元素的class是一个常见的需求,通过的介绍和总结,相信读者对Vue获取DOM元素的class...
1. 原生js获取dom元素: document.querySelector(选择器)document.getElementById(id选择器)document.getElementsByClassName(class选择器) 2. ref获取单个dom元素: <template></template>import{ ref}from'vue'constdivDom =ref(null);onMounted(()=>{console.log('获取dom元素',divDom) }) 3. ref获取v-for循...
1. 原生js获取dom元素: document.querySelector(选择器) document.getElementById(id选择器) document.getElementsByClassName(class选择器) 1. 2. 3. 2. ref获取单个dom元素: <template> </template> import { ref} from 'vue' const divDom =
2、使用 ref 获取页面 DOM 元素 在使用 JS/Jquery 获取页面的 DOM 元素时,我们一般是根据 id、class、标签、属性等其它标识来获取到页面上的 DOM 元素。嗯,可以说,我们很难抛弃 Jquery 的一个重大原因,就是当我们需要获取到页面上的 DOM 元素时,使用 Jquery 的API相比于原生的 JS 代码,简单到极致,有木有。
ref 属性 在vue项目里面,我们在js里面要获取页面的标签里面的东西,我们不用原生的js语句,我们可以在页面的标签上加一个ref属性,写法如下 js里面获取是 props属性 需求 一个组件,多个地方用,但是里面需要渲染的数据是不一样的,那么我们需要在这个组件里面写这个属性,这个属性就是接受传到这个组件里面的东西 ...
51CTO博客已为您找到关于vue获取class节点的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及vue获取class节点问答内容。更多vue获取class节点相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
在父组件中的子组件里会打印一个proxy(实例),通过实例去获取里面的属性或者值setup() { const commer = ref(null) onMounted(()=>{ console.log(commer); console.log(commer.value); }) return { commer } }看这个例子:父组件:<template> This is an about page <com ref="commer"></com> 通过ref...